12089258233039779937581719063636213764626
Even
12089258233039779937581719063636213764626 is even
Previous even number is 12089258233039779937581719063636213764624
Next even number is 12089258233039779937581719063636213764628
Cubed
1766847080954352398136409673227723941118272209360959748286750591511203772628349409107801389000568170383958926032277106376
Squared
146150164625120102164837629044148301806650281549664503536580646485175587328919876
Binary
10001110000110111100100111000110010010101010010100101000101001001000001000000010001000000101001100000010000000000000000001001000010010